Factors Influencing Key Replacement Costs
When assessing the expense of changing a Citroen key, a number of elements contribute:
Type of Key:
- Traditional keys
- Transponder keys
- Smart keys/ Keyless entry fobs
Design and Year of Vehicle: Replacement expenses can differ based on the specific design of the car and its year of manufacture.
Key Source:
- Dealerships
- Independent locksmith professionals
- Online sources
Place: Prices may vary based on geographic location and the schedule of particular services.
Programming Needs: Many modern-day keys need shows to sync with the car's immobilizer system, contributing to the overall cost.

Comprehensive Breakdown of Costs
Conventional Keys:.Conventional keys are the easiest and least costly choice. Citroen Relay Key Replacement can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150, depending upon whether you go through a car dealership or an independent locksmith professional. Programs is normally not needed, which assists keep expenses low.
Transponder Keys:.These keys consist of a chip that communicates with the car's immobilizer system. Changing a transponder key might cost between ₤ 100 and ₤ 250, primarily due to the programs required. While independent locksmiths can often offer this service, costs may be higher at car dealerships.

Where to Get a Replacement Key
When it concerns replacing a Citroen key, there are a number of options readily available:
Dealership:
- Highest expense however warranties that you get an authentic key.
- Can offer programming services automatically.
Independent Locksmith:
- Typically more affordable than car dealerships.
- Guarantee they have experience with Citroen vehicles to prevent compatibility concerns.
Online Suppliers:
- Websites frequently provide keys at a lowered cost.
- May require self-programming, which can be complicated for some designs.

Frequently Asked Questions About Citroen Key Replacement
Q1: How long does it require to get a replacement key?A1: The
timespan can vary. Dealers may take a couple of days due to shipping, while locksmiths can frequently offer quicker service, in some cases on the same day.
Q2: Can I program a key myself?A2: Some older models
permit self-programming, but lots of modern Citroen keys need specific devices, making it suggested to look for expert support. Q3: Is it possible to get a spare key?A3: Yes, it is highly suggested to have an extra key. The process resembles replacing a lost key but frequently costs less because programs is normally not needed.
